Take advantage of discounts

Car insurance is not cheap, buy you may qualify for discounts that you may not know about. Larger premium reductions will be automatically applied when you complete an application, but lesser-known reductions have to be specially asked for before they will apply.

  • Own a Home – Owning a home can save you money because of the fact that having a home demonstrates responsibility.
  • Discount for Life Insurance – Larger companies have lower rates if you buy life insurance from them.
  • Passive Restraint Discount – Factory air bags and/or automatic seat belt systems can receive discounts up to 30%.
  • Early Switch Discount – Select companies give a discount for buying a policy before your current policy expires. It’s a savings of about 10%.
  • Discounts for Safe Drivers – Insureds without accidents can pay as much as 50% less on Prizm coverage than drivers with accidents.
  • Seat Belts Save – Buckling up and requiring all passengers to buckle their seat belts could cut 10% or more off your medical payments premium.
  • Multi-policy Discount – When you have multiple policies with one insurance company you will save at least 10% off all policies.
  • Discount for Good Grades – A discount for being a good student can be rewarded with saving of up to 25%. Earning this discount can benefit you up to age 25.
  • Braking Control Discount – Vehicles with anti-lock braking systems can reduce accidents and earn discounts up to 10%.
  • Distant Student – Children who attend school more than 100 miles from home and do not have a car may be able to be covered for less.

It’s important to note that most discounts do not apply to the entire cost. The majority will only reduce the price of certain insurance coverages like liability, collision or medical payments. So even though it sounds like adding up those discounts means a free policy, you’re out of luck. But any discount will bring down your overall premium however.

Some factors that can determine what Chevy Prizm insurance costs

It’s important that you understand some of the elements that help determine the rates you pay for insurance coverage. Knowing what impacts premium levels empowers consumers to make smart changes that could result in better insurance coverage rates.

  • Do you need the policy add-ons? – There are a lot of additional coverages that can waste your money if you aren’t careful. Insurance for vanishing deductibles, accident forgiveness and term life insurance may be wasting your money. They may seem good when talking to your agent, but if they’re wasting money eliminate the coverages to reduce your premium.
  • Adjust deductibles and save – Physical damage deductibles represent how much money you are willing to pay out-of-pocket in the event of a claim. Physical damage insurance, termed comprehensive and collision coverage on your policy, is used to repair damage to your car. Some instances where coverage would apply would be colliding with a building, damage from fire, or theft. The more you are required to pay out-of-pocket, the less your company will charge you for insurance on Prizm coverage.
  • Sex matters – The statistics show that women are safer drivers than men. However, don’t assume that men are WORSE drivers than women. They both tend to get into accidents in similar percentages, but men cause more damage and cost insurance companies more money. Men also get cited for more serious violations such as reckless driving.
  • Bundling policies can get discounts – Most companies will award you with lower prices to people who carry more than one policy, otherwise known as a multi-policy discount. Even if you’re getting this discount you still need to comparison shop to confirm you are receiving the best rates possible. You may still be able to find better rates by insuring with multiple companies.
  • A clean driving record saves money – Your driving citation history has a big impact on rates. Drivers who don’t get tickets get better rates than bad drivers. Even one moving violation can bump up the cost by twenty percent. Drivers who have serious citations such as DUI or reckless driving may need to submit a SR-22 form with their state motor vehicle department in order to continue driving.

The coverage is in the details

Learning about specific coverages of car insurance helps when choosing which coverages you need and proper limits and deductibles. The coverage terms in a policy can be confusing and nobody wants to actually read their policy. These are the usual coverages offered by car insurance companies.

Comprehensive auto coverage

Comprehensive insurance pays to fix your vehicle from damage from a wide range of events other than collision. A deductible will apply then the remaining damage will be covered by your comprehensive coverage.

Comprehensive can pay for things such as rock chips in glass, falling objects, theft, damage from a tornado or hurricane and hail damage. The maximum amount you can receive from a comprehensive claim is the actual cash value, so if your deductible is as high as the vehicle’s value it’s probably time to drop comprehensive insurance.

Collision coverage

This coverage covers damage to your Prizm from colliding with an object or car. A deductible applies and the rest of the damage will be paid by collision coverage.

Collision can pay for claims such as colliding with a tree, scraping a guard rail, backing into a parked car and damaging your car on a curb. Collision coverage makes up a good portion of your premium, so you might think about dropping it from lower value vehicles. It’s also possible to increase the deductible to get cheaper collision coverage.

Medical payments and PIP coverage

Personal Injury Protection (PIP) and medical payments coverage kick in for expenses for rehabilitation expenses, hospital visits and nursing services. They are utilized in addition to your health insurance policy or if you do not have health coverage. Coverage applies to not only the driver but also the vehicle occupants as well as being hit by a car walking across the street. PIP coverage is not an option in every state but it provides additional coverages not offered by medical payments coverage

UM/UIM (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ist) coverage

This coverage protects you and your vehicle when other motorists either have no liability insurance or not enough. This coverage pays for injuries to you and your family and also any damage incurred to your Chevy Prizm.

Due to the fact that many drivers have only the minimum liability required by law, their liability coverage can quickly be exhausted. That’s why carrying high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ist coverage should not be overlooked. Normally your uninsured/underinsured motorist coverages do not exceed the liability coverage limits.

Liability coverage

Liability coverage can cover damages or injuries you inflict on other’s property or people in an accident. It protects YOU against claims from other people, and doesn’t cover damage to your own property or vehicle.

It consists of three limits, bodily injury per person, bodily injury per accident and property damage. You commonly see policy limits of 50/100/50 which stand for $50,000 in coverage for each person’s injuries, a per accident bodily injury limit of $100,000, and a limit of $50,000 paid for damaged property. Some companies may use a combined limit which limits claims to one amount with no separate limits for injury or property damage.

Liability coverage protects against things such as medical services, court costs and attorney fees. How much liability coverage do you need? That is a decision to put some thought into, but consider buying as high a limit as you can afford.
